SAN JOSE -- The San Jose Sharks needed an answer, and they needed it desperately.
Their fast start in Game 5 of the Western Conference Second Round on Saturday had been negated by another goal from Shark-killer Mike Fisher, and it appeared the Nashville Predators would emerge from a first period on the road tied 1-1, a result that would be considered a win after the disparity in play between the teams through the first 20 minutes.
